The Science of Terroir in Coconut Processing
Coconuts are not homogenous.

Their flavor profile is a direct reflection of soil composition, microclimate, and even the care with which they’re harvested—factors rarely quantified in mainstream production. Mae Ploy’s process begins with a meticulous sourcing protocol: only copra from Ratchaburi Province, where volcanic loam and consistent rainfall yield a distinct fatty acid matrix. Unlike industrial co-processing that homogenizes fat globules through high-heat refining, Mae Ploy employs a low-temperature, enzymatic extraction, preserving the delicate chain-length distribution of lauric acid and caprylic acid. These compounds define not just mouthfeel, but the very authenticity of “coconutness” as perceived by trained sensory panels.
In 2022, a collaborative study by Chulalongkorn University’s Food Science Institute revealed that conventional methods often degrade volatile esters—key aroma compounds—during ultra-pasteurization, reducing perceived richness by up to 37%.

Mae Ploy’s proprietary cold-press technique, validated by gas chromatography-mass spectrometry (GC-MS), retains 92% of these esters. The result? A cream that delivers not just sweetness, but a layered aroma: toasted coconut, faint floral lift, and a subtle nuttiness—sensory markers that signal genuine authenticity to connoisseurs.
Precision in Fermentation: The Invisible Engine
Fermentation, often treated as a black box, is the unseen architect of flavor depth. Mae Ploy’s approach treats it as a controlled biochemical reaction. Using indigenous lactic acid bacteria isolated from traditional Thai coconut sap cultures, the fermentation phase lasts precisely 72 hours at 36°C.

This duration, confirmed through in-house microbial sequencing, optimizes the breakdown of complex carbohydrates into lactic and acetic acids—compounds that enhance umami and balance sweetness without artificial intervention.
This is where the difference lies: most commercial coconut creams rely on synthetic stabilizers and shortcut enzymatic actions to mimic complexity. Mae Ploy’s method, by contrast, leverages microbial precision to generate natural umami, a sensory signature increasingly linked to perceived authenticity. A 2023 blind taste test conducted by Bangkok’s Institute of Sensory Science found that 68% of trained evaluators preferred Mae Ploy over premium imported brands—particularly for dishes requiring subtlety, such as curries and desserts where flavor layering matters most.
Standardization vs. Soul: Navigating the Precision Paradox
The pursuit of authenticity through precision carries inherent tension. Scaling artisanal processes risks homogenization, diluting the very uniqueness that defines premium coconut creams. Mae Ploy confronts this by embedding variability into their quality control—each batch undergoes spectral fingerprinting via near-infrared (NIR) spectroscopy, ensuring consistency while preserving batch-to-batch nuance.
This hybrid model—precision without sterility—offers a blueprint for the industry.
Yet, challenges persist. The reliance on small-scale copra limits production volume, keeping prices above mass-market alternatives. Additionally, consumer perception remains a hurdle: many associate “premium” with branding, not process. Mae Ploy combats this through transparency—open-kitchen demonstrations, soil-to-cream traceability apps, and sensory workshops that demystify the craft.
